What Does GREEN Build Mean To You
GREEN building is a catch-all phrase used to describe environmentally friendly construction. It includes many different aspects of the home, from planting shade trees to saving energy to installing water efficient plumbing. But, while GREEN building is driven by a desire to reduce the environmental impact of your home, it’s also good for you.
GREEN homes consider your pocketbook. They cost less to heat, cool and maintain, and-if you ever decide to sell-they’re usually worth more.
GREEN homes consider your health. Because they’re built to minimize chemicals, mold and other harmful substances, they protect you and your family from exposure.
GREEN homes are quality homes. They’re built for durability, so they require less maintenance.
